The iconic milestone for the community was the AC Web Ultimate Repack . It focused primarily on patch 3.3.5a ( Wrath of the Lich King ). This era achieved widespread popularity due to the introduction of integrated Lua engines like Eluna. Eluna allowed developers to write simple scripts to modify game behavior without needing to recompile the server's entire C++ core. The Modern Successors: AzerothCore and SPP
